将 'Screen Zoom' 设置更改为 'Large' 完全弄乱了我应用程序中的几个屏幕(尤其是片段布局)

Changing 'Screen Zoom' setting to 'Large' completely messing few screens (especially fragment layout) in my App

我们知道 'Android-N (7.0)' 引入了新功能,我们可以在设备设置中更改 'Screen-Zoom' 等级。但是将 'Screen Zoom' 级别更改为 'Large' 完全弄乱了我应用程序中的几个屏幕(尤其是片段布局)。正如所建议的 here, I have specified dimensions with Density-independent Pixel (dp), also I tried solutions given to 但不幸的是 none 这对我有用。如果您对此问题有任何解决方案,或者是否有任何方法可以忽略 'Screen Zoom' 设置效果,特别是对于我们的应用程序,请告诉我。

谢谢。

我试过这个third-party library,它解决了将近 85% 的问题。